非 Mysql,你需要了解的数据库管理软件(mysql 不以开头)
在数据库管理领域,Mysql是最为常用的数据库管理软件之一。但是,还有许多其他数据库管理软件值得探究和了解。这些数据库管理软件使用的语言、运行速度、存储方式等各方面有所不同,选择适合自己的数据库管理软件是至关重要的工作。本文将介绍几个非Mysql的数据库管理软件,并且让您了解其功能和用途。
1. PostgreSQL
PostgreSQL是一个开放源代码的关系型数据库管理系统。与Mysql一样,它采用SQL语言进行查询操作。不过PostgreSQL在高并发处理能力和数据安全方面表现更出色。它还支持自定义数据类型和函数,可扩展性和灵活性更强。
安装方法示例:
sudo apt-get install postgresql
2. MongoDB
MongoDB是一种非关系型数据库。它采用了BSON(Binary JSON)格式存储数据,可用于存储大数据和实时数据。MongoDB是面向文档的数据库,其中文档通常以JSON格式存储。与关系型数据库不同,MongoDB的表结构不固定,存储不同类型的文档非常方便。
安装方法示例:
sudo apt-get install mongodb
3. Cassandra
Cassandra是一种分布式非关系型数据库。它以分布式的方式存储数据,因此具备出色的可扩展性。Cassandra支持较高的吞吐量和低延迟访问,适合大量数据的实时查询操作。与其他非关系型数据库相比,Cassandra支持更丰富的数据类型、数据量和查询能力。
安装方法示例:
sudo apt-get install cassandra
4. Redis
Redis是一种基于内存的高性能非关系型数据库。它采用了键值对存储方式。Redis支持数据持久化,并可将数据写入磁盘。Redis通常用作高速缓存和消息队列,适合处理需要高速读写操作的应用程序。
安装方法示例:
sudo apt-get install redis-server
总结:
不同的数据库管理软件有不同的用途和特性。 Postgresql、MongoDB、Cassandra和Redis分别适用于不同的场景。更重要的是,对于不同的开发团队,您应该选择适合您的数据库管理软件。这些非Mysql的数据库管理软件都是值得探讨的,它们比Mysql提供了更多样化的解决方案。您可以根据自己的需求选择和探索不同的数据库管理软件,以最大程度地提高自己的工作效率和数据安全性。